Method
Ice Cream Preparation
- 1
Mix the Base
In a large mixing bowl, combine heavy cream, whole milk, granulated sugar,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t. Whisk together until the sugar is completely dissolved.
- 2
Chill the Mixture
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 2 hours or overnight. This will enhance the flavors.
- 3
Churn the Ice Cream
Pour the chilled mixture into an ice cream maker and churn according to the manufacturer's instructions until it reaches a soft-serve consistency.
- 4
Freeze
Transfer the churned ice cream to an airtight container and freeze for at least 4 hours or until firm.
Sorbet Preparation
- 5
Make the Syrup
In a small saucepan, combine granulated sugar and water. Heat over medium heat, stirring until the sugar completely dissolves. Remove from heat and let it cool.
- 6
Combine Ingredients
In a blender, combine the fruit puree, cooled syrup, lemon juice, and a pinch of salt. Blend until smooth.
- 7
Chill the Mixture
Refrigerate the mixture for at least 1 hour to allow the flavors to meld.
- 8
Churn the Sorbet
Pour the chilled mixture into an ice cream maker and churn according to the manufacturer's instructions until it is light and fluffy.
- 9
Freeze
Transfer the churned sorbet to an airtight container and freeze for at least 3 hours or until firm.
